    Arizona Cardinals running back Jonathan Dwyer was arrested for domestic violence on Wednesday, reports Arizona TV anchor Tyler Baldwin.

    CBS confirmed Dwyer's arrest and reported that he has been charged with aggravated assault and preventing someone from calling 911.

    Baldwin also reported that Dwyer is being questioned from a fight with his wife "from awhile ago." She reportedly saved the records of her injuries.

    Dwyer's reported arrest comes as NFL faces heavy scrutiny over its handling of domestic violence cases.

    Dwyer, 25, is listed as the No. 2 running back on the Cardinals' depth chart. He has rushed for 51 yards and a touchdown on 16 carries over two games this season.

    He signed with Arizona this offseason after spending the first four seasons of his career with the Pittsburgh Steelers.

    The Cardinals (2-0) host the San Francisco 49ers on Sunday.
